First things first, businesses need to understand what digital transformation means for them and how it can benefit their operations. It’s not just about implementing new technology, but also about changing the way things are done to improve efficiency, customer experience, and overall business performance. 💻

One key step in developing a digital transformation strategy is conducting a thorough assessment of the current state of the business. This includes identifying areas for improvement, such as outdated technology or inefficient processes, and determining how digital solutions can address these issues. 📊

Once the assessment is complete, businesses can start to prioritize the areas where digital transformation can have the biggest impact. This may involve investing in new technology, such as cloud computing or artificial intelligence, or optimizing existing systems to improve performance. 💡

It’s important to note that digital transformation is not a one-time project, but an ongoing journey. Businesses need to continuously evaluate and adapt their strategy to keep up with changing technologies and customer needs. This requires a culture of innovation and a willingness to experiment and take risks. 🚀

Another important factor in developing a digital transformation strategy is having the right talent in place. This includes not only technical expertise but also a deep understanding of the business and its goals. Hiring and training employees with the right skills and mindset is essential to successfully implementing digital solutions. 💪

Finally, businesses need to communicate their digital transformation strategy clearly and frequently to all stakeholders, including employees, customers, and investors. This helps to build buy-in and support for the changes being made, and ensures that everyone is working towards the same goal. 🔊

In conclusion, developing a digital transformation strategy requires a lot of hard work and dedication, but the benefits can be significant. By embracing digital solutions and adapting to changing technologies, businesses can improve their performance, enhance customer experience, and stay ahead of the competition. 💯
